Snipping Tool is easy to access and use.

after you grab your screenshot, use the Pen and Highlighter to call attention to certain areas.

Snipping Tool is a free app that comes standard with most Windows computers running Windows Vista and later.

A screenshot of the Snipping Tool app that shows off the app’s snipping Mode menu and its four different screenshot modes.

To access it, typeSnipping Toolinto the Windows search bar.

Best for Multitasking: ShareX

No ads.

A screenshot of ShareX’s main screen which includes a pretty extensive sidebar menu on the left side of the app and list of hotkeys you can use with ShareX listed in the middle of the app’s workspace.

It’s a professional-grade app, so some of the terminology may be confusing to newbies.

ShareX isn’t just a simple screenshot app.

It also allows you to upload images and perform additional tasks.

ShareX can alsorecord your screenand help you createGIFs.

ShareX is free to download and use and requires Windows 10 or higher.
